You can dye clothes in a washing machine using all-purpose fabric dye like Rit, but success depends on fabric type, hot water cycles, and thorough post-dye cleaning to avoid color transfer. Dyeing clothes in a washing machine is straightforward with fiber-reactive or all-purpose dyes on a hot cycle, but pre-wash items, use salt or vinegar fixatives, and run a cleaning cycle afterward to ensure.
